Abstract

The utility model relates to the field of fishing tackle, and provides a dip net connecting piece which is used for quickly assembling and disassembling a net head and a handle of a dip net; in addition, the utility model also provides a dip net equipped with the dip net connecting piece; the dip net connecting piece comprises a first connecting piece and a second connecting piece which are mutually inserted; a fixing groove is formed in the first connecting piece; the second connecting piece is provided with a convex part; the protruding part is inserted into the fixing groove and limited by the fixing groove along the inserting direction of the first connecting piece and the second connecting piece; the second connecting piece is also provided with a propping device; the abutting device can move on the second connecting piece in a reciprocating mode and abuts against the first fixing piece, so that the protruding portion abuts against the inside of the fixing groove; the first connecting piece is provided with a first connecting groove; the second connecting piece is provided with a second connecting hole; the diddle-net comprises a net head and a handle which are detachably connected, and also comprises the diddle-net connecting piece as described above.

Landing net connecting piece and landing net
Technical Field
The utility model relates to the field of fishing tackle, in particular to a dip net connecting piece and a dip net.
Background
The dip net is a tool for fishing in motion, generally comprises a net head and a handle, and the net head and the handle are assembled and arranged in the conventional dip net for convenient carrying, and a connecting structure is arranged between the net head and the handle; the existing net head is connected with the handle through a bolt thread, the bolt is arranged on the net head, the thread is arranged on the end surface of the handle, and the net head can be screwed into the handle; however, as the demand of the angler increases, the connection mode gradually shows disadvantages, because the rotation of the net head and the rotation of the handle are very troublesome due to the volume and the length, and therefore, a connecting piece which can quickly connect the net head and the handle is required to be arranged.

Detailed Description
The technical solution of the present invention is further explained with reference to the drawings and the embodiments.
A dip net connecting piece comprises a first connecting piece 1 and a second connecting piece 2 which are mutually inserted; a fixing groove 111 is formed in the first connecting piece 1; the second connecting piece 2 is provided with a convex part; when the first connecting piece 1 is inserted into the second connecting piece 2, the protruding part is inserted into the fixing groove 111 and is limited by the fixing groove 111 in the inserting direction of the first connecting piece 1 and the second connecting piece 2, so that the second connecting piece 2 cannot be separated from the first connecting piece 1 along the inserting direction; the second connecting piece 2 is also provided with a propping device; the abutting device can move on the second connecting piece 2 in a reciprocating mode and abuts against the first fixing piece, so that the protruding portion abuts against the inside of the fixing groove 111, and the protruding portion is prevented from being out of position; the first connecting piece 1 is provided with a first connecting groove 121, the first connecting groove 121 is used for connecting with a diddle-net handle, and the connecting mode can be interference fit, buckle connection or threaded connection; the second connecting piece 2 is provided with a second connecting hole 25, the second connecting hole 25 is used for being connected with a bolt on the net head of the diddle-net, the connecting mode can be interference fit, buckling connection or threaded connection, and in the embodiment, the second connecting hole 25 is a threaded hole and is in threaded connection with the net head of the diddle-net.
The first connecting piece 1 comprises a first accommodating part 11 for accommodating the first connecting piece 1 and a second accommodating part 12 connected with the diddle-net handle, in the embodiment, the first accommodating part 11 and the second accommodating part 12 are both cylindrical structures, the end surfaces of the first accommodating part 11 and the second accommodating part 12 are connected and integrally formed, and the diameter of the first accommodating part 11 is slightly smaller than that of the second accommodating part 12; the plurality of fixing grooves 111 are formed in the end face of the first accommodating portion 11, the number of the fixing grooves 111 is the same as the number of the protrusions, and the number of the fixing grooves 111 is two in the embodiment; the fixing groove 111 includes: an entrance groove 1111, a transition groove 1112 and a limit groove 1113; the entering groove 1111 is opened on the free end surface of the first accommodating part 11 along the axial direction of the first accommodating part 11; the transition groove 1112 is communicated with the entering groove 1111 and is arranged along the radial direction of the first accommodating part 11; the limiting groove 1113 is arranged at one end of the transition groove 1112 and is communicated with the transition groove 1112; the opening direction of the limiting groove 1113 is parallel to the entering groove 1111 and is an inverted groove of the entering groove 1111; when the abutting device abuts against the first fixing piece, the protruding portion can abut against the bottom of the limiting groove 1113, the second connecting piece 2 is limited, the second connecting piece 2 is prevented from being separated from the first connecting piece 1, and the second connecting piece 2 can be prevented from horizontally rotating.
The first accommodating part 11 and the second accommodating part 12 are cylindrical structures; the free end face of the first accommodating part 11 is provided with an accommodating hole 112 for accommodating the second connector 2 (i.e. matching with the second connector 2 for plugging); the fixing groove 111 is formed in the hole wall of the accommodating hole 112; the first accommodating part 11 is connected with the second accommodating part 12 and is integrally formed; the first connecting groove 121 opens on the end face of the free end of the second accommodating portion 12.
A placing hole 122 communicated with the accommodating hole 112 is formed at the bottom of the first connecting groove 121; an elastic member 3 is disposed in the placement hole 122, and the elastic member 3 includes: a mounting piece 31, a pressing spring 32, and a retainer plate 33; the mounting piece 31 is fixed in the placing hole 122; the supporting plate 33 is movably arranged in the placing hole 122 and is close to the accommodating hole 112; the pressure spring 32 is arranged between the mounting piece 31 and the supporting plate 33; as the projection gradually moves toward the transition groove 1112 along the entry groove 1111, the end of the second connector 2 simultaneously moves toward the placing hole 122; when the protruding part moves to the bottom of the groove 1111, the end of the second connecting part 2 is already in contact with the supporting plate 33, the supporting plate 33 is pressed downwards, the pressure spring 32 is compressed, when the protruding part moves along the transition groove 1112, the end of the second connecting part 2 is always in contact with the supporting plate 33, the pressure spring 32 is always in a compressed state, when the protruding part moves to the limiting groove 1113, the pressure spring 32 is reset (but still in a compressed state and not completely reset), the supporting plate 33 pushes the second connecting part 2 in the opposite direction, and the protruding part is abutted against the limiting groove 1113.
The second connecting piece 2 is of a round rod 23 structure; the abutting device is a lantern ring 21; the lantern ring 21 is sleeved on the second connecting piece 2 in a threaded manner and can reciprocate on the second connecting piece 2 through a threaded structure; the second connecting piece 2 is provided with a through hole 24 along the radial direction; a fixed limit column is inserted into the through hole 24; two ends of the limiting column extend out of the second connecting piece 2 to form the two convex parts; the second connection hole 25 is opened on the end face of the second connector 2.
A flange 22 for limiting the lantern ring 21 is arranged on the surface of the second connecting piece 2 beside the second connecting hole 25; the rib 22 prevents the collar 21 from sliding back out of the second connector 2; the outer surface of the lantern ring 21 is carved with anti-skidding lines 211, which is convenient for a fisherman to screw, when the round rod 23 is propped against the limiting groove 1113, the lantern ring 21 is screwed towards the first connecting piece 1 until the lantern ring 21 is contacted with the free end surface of the first accommodating part 11, and then the round rod 23 is continuously screwed until the round rod is screwed, so that the round rod 23 can be limited and fixed for the second time, and is prevented from falling out of the limiting groove 1113; the lantern ring 21 and the elastic piece 3 jointly realize the limiting and fixing of the round rod 23, and the fixing effect is good due to double insurance.
The outer part of the first accommodating part 11 is sleeved with a protective sleeve 4 with an annular structure; the protective sleeve 4 shields the fixing groove 111 for preventing sundries from entering the fixing groove 111.
The utility model also provides a dip net, which comprises a net head and a handle which are detachably connected, and also comprises the dip net connecting piece as described above; the first connecting piece 1 is fixed with one end of the handle; the second connecting piece 2 is fixed with the net head; when the first connecting piece 1 is matched and spliced with the second connecting piece 2, the net head and the handle are connected.
